Localization Engineer develops and produces localized versions of the company's products and services. Supports the creation and maintenance of localization test specifications and scripts for automating localization testing. Being a Localization Engineer tests localized products according to test specifications. Identifies, prioritizes and fixes localization bugs according to established procedures. Additionally, Localization Engineer applies working knowledge of networks, operating systems, hardware, software, and testing/production environments in performing work assignments. Requires a bachelor's degree. Typically reports to a supervisor. The Localization Engineer occasionally directed in several aspects of the work. Gains exposure to some of the complex tasks within the job function. To be a Localization Engineer typically requires 2 -4 years of related experience.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)

  • MWH Constructors, a global leader in heavy civil construction of water and wastewater facilities, is currently seeking a Project Engineer to support a PFAS mitigation project in Madison, Maine.

    Essential Functions

    The Project Engineer will provide technical support to project management and project supervision staff to ensure construction work is performed efficiently, on schedule and in accordance company policy and engineering standards.

    • Assist with subcontractor procurement and management, package development, construction layout, material and equipment procurement, submittal review, manpower scheduling, quantity takeoffs, labor productivity reporting, document controls, material purchases, deliveries and inventory, and project controls.
    • Perform ongoing quality inspections; verify all completed work complies with applicable permits, codes, drawings, and specifications.
    • Prepare and disseminate all required documentation records such as materials and equipment submittals, status reports, sketches of work already completed, material requirement calculations, etc., to supervisor.
    • Prepare drawings and sketches to support construction work, temporary works, work method statements, change orders, estimates, etc.
    • Prepare/facilitate and submit work method statements, ensure requisite approvals and permits are obtained prior to work commencement.
    • Research resolutions to drawing interpretation problems, conflicts, interferences, and errors. Initiate RFI’s and follow through to resolution.
    • Layout and provide necessary building control lines and elevations for accurate measurement and correct installation of materials.
    • Establish and implement office procedures as they relate to the administration of construction contracts.
    • Implement projects controls for distribution and record keeping of correspondence, technical records, and other project documents.
    • Review all incoming correspondence and initiate action on it, record minutes of the weekly and monthly project site meeting, review and process the Contractor’s pay applications, review of the project schedule, process RFI’s and produce weekly and monthly construction progress reports.
    • Ensure Project management systems are maintained up-to-date and accurate.
    • Assist with review and analyze Contractor claims, prepare change orders, and manage claims and change order records.
    • Assist estimating staff with quantity takeoffs and solicitation of subcontractors and material vendors.
    • Work in a manner to ensure your personal safety and that of fellow employees but following the company health and safety guidelines and policies.
    • Assist in resolving construction problem/issues and perform additional assignments per supervisor’s direction.

    Basic Qualifications

    • Bachelor’s degree in Construction Management, Civil, Electrical or Mechanical Engineering or related field; equivalent combination of experience, skills and training may be substituted.
    • 2-3 years’ field construction experience at the jobsite level.
    • Experience on heavy civil construction projects.
    • Working knowledge of construction equipment techniques, drawings, and specifications, building materials, and required standards applicable to discipline.
    • Ability to assume responsibility and work within a larger team environment.
    • Ability to interface and communicate effectively with others.
    • Familiarity with Project Management data base systems such as Primavera Contract Manager, Expedition, SharePoint, etc.

Anson is a town in Somerset County, Maine, United States. The population was 2,511 at the 2010 census. It includes the villages of Anson and North Anson. According to the United States Census Bureau, the town has a total area of 48.29 square miles (125.07 km2), of which, 47.49 square miles (123.00 km2) of it is land and 0.80 square miles (2.07 km2) is water. Anson is drained by Mill Stream, Gilbert Brook, Lemon Stream, the Carrabassett River and the Kennebec River. The town is crossed by U. S. 201A and state routes 16, 43, 148 and 234.
